Top 5 City Building Games on iOS in Brazil for Q3 2021

The third quarter of 2021 saw intriguing performance trends for the top city building games on iOS in Brazil. Here’s a breakdown of the key metrics for these games, according to Sensor Tower data.

SimCity BuildIt from Electronic Arts experienced fluctuations in both weekly revenue and downloads throughout the quarter. Weekly revenue peaked at approximately $4.1K at the end of June and saw a low of around $1.2K in late September. Downloads varied, reaching a high of about 4.7K in mid-September and a low of around 2.3K in early August. Active users hovered around 37K at the beginning of the quarter, dropping to approximately 31K by the end of September.

The Simpsons™: Tapped Out, also from Electronic Arts, had more stable but lower revenue figures, peaking at about $1K in early August. Downloads showed a gradual increase, peaking at 2K in mid-September. The game’s active user base remained relatively stable, starting the quarter at around 12.4K and ending at approximately 11.9K.

Merge Mayor by Starberry Games GmbH had modest weekly revenue, peaking at around $381 in early July. Downloads showed significant variability, with a high of 665 in early July and a low of just 3 in mid-September. Active users reached a peak of 834 in mid-July before gradually declining to 346 by the end of the quarter.

Megapolis: City Building Sim from Social Quantum saw its highest weekly revenue of around $484 in early August. Downloads were highest at 1.1K in mid-September, with a notable spike in active users from 115 at the start of the quarter to around 787 in mid-September.

The Tribez: Build a Village by Game Insight had more modest figures, with weekly revenue peaking at approximately $311 at the end of June. Downloads were generally low throughout the quarter, with a significant increase to 212 in late September. Active users started at around 416 and ended at approximately 334.
